October Book Picks

Posted on: September 28, 2023

Joe and Emma share what books released in October 2023 that they’re MOST excited for. Get your TBRs ready!

Emma’s Picks: 

  1. Lucky Me by Rich Paul
  2. The Unmaking of June Farrow by Adrienne Young
  3. Wildfire by Hannah Grace
  4. A Curse for True Love by Stephanie Garber
  5. A Holly Jolly Ever After by Julie Murphy & Sierra Simone (Snow Place Like LA)
  6. Midnight is the Darkest Hour by Ashley Winstead
  7. The Sun Sets in Singapore by Kehinde Fadipe
  8. Making It So by Patrick Stewart

Joe’s Picks:

  1. The Forest Demands Its Due by Kosoko Jackson
  2. Let Us Descend by Jesmyn Ward
  3. Brooms by Jasmine Walls
  4. The List by Yomi Adegoke
  5. The Woman in Me by Britney Spears
  6. Family Meal by Bryan Washington
  7. Mary and the Birth of Frankestein by Anne Eekhout
  8. The Scandalous Confessions of Lydia Bennet, Witch by Melinda Taub
